Chatham Capital Partners and Fortress Acquire Global Ship Systems

On June 1, 2004, mezzanine finance firm Chatham Capital Partners and asset manager Fortress acquired marine company Global Ship Systems

Investment Fate
  • Global Ship Systems went bankrupt in 2007.

DESCRIPTION

Chatham Capital Partners is a mezzanine finance firm that provides capital to lower middle-market companies. Chatham looks for investments in healthcare, manufacturing, and service companies with revenues of $10 to $50 million. Chatham will consider opportunities across the US with a preference for companies located in the Eastern and South regions of the US. Chatham will not consider early-stage, venture capital or real estate investments. Chatham was formed in 2001 and is based in Atlanta, Georgia.

DESCRIPTION

Fortress is a public investment firm that manages hedge fund, credit, and private equity investments. Fortress' private equity practice primarily makes control-oriented investments in North American and Western European businesses with significant asset-bases and strong cash-flows. Fortress is open to investing in a wide range of sectors, however the Firm has tended towards capital intensive sectors. These include transportation, financials, senior living/healthcare, real estate, media & telecommunications, leisure and energy infrastructure. The pivate equity group also invests in publicly traded alternative investment vehicles, which Fortress refers to as 'castles' that primarily invest in real estate and real estate related debt. Fortress was formed in 1998 and is based in New York City.
